What is Kazakhstan Tenge (KZT)

The Kazakhstan Tenge, abbreviated as KZT, is the official currency of Kazakhstan. It was introduced on November 15, 1993, replacing the Soviet ruble at a rate of 500 KZT for 1 ruble. The name "tenge" is derived from a Turkic word that means "scale" or "balance," reflecting the culture and heritage of the people.

KZT is subdivided into 100 tiyn. Although tiyn coins are rarely in circulation, the Tenge is issued in both coins and banknotes, with denominations varying from 1 Tenge to 20,000 Tenge. The design of the banknotes features notable figures, historical events, and symbols representing Kazakhstan's rich cultural heritage and patriotism.

The Tenge's value can fluctuate based on various factors such as economic conditions, oil prices (as Kazakhstan is a significant oil producer), inflation rates, and overall demand for the currency. When converting KZT to another currency, it is essential to consider these fluctuations, which can affect exchange rates.

What is Ukrainian Hryvnia (UAH)

The Ukrainian Hryvnia, abbreviated as UAH, is the national currency of Ukraine. It was introduced in 1996, in the wake of the dissolution of the Soviet Union, to establish a stable and independent monetary system. The Ukrainian Hryvnia is named after the old Slavic word "hryvna," which referred to a gold or silver piece used as a unit of weight and value in medieval times.

The Hryvnia is further divided into 100 kopecks. Like the Tenge, the Hryvnia is available in both coins and banknotes, with denominations ranging from 1 Hryvnia to 1,000 Hryvnias. The design of the banknotes reflects Ukraine’s history, cultural landmarks, and prominent figures from its past.

The exchange rate of UAH is influenced by numerous factors such as economic growth, political stability, and external influences like trade relationships or sanctions. As with any currency conversion, it’s vital to stay updated with the current exchange rates, as these can change rapidly.
